怎么制作静态热力图标图片
-
制作静态热力图标图片需要经过一系列步骤,包括准备数据、选择合适的工具、设计样式和颜色等。以下是制作静态热力图标图片的详细步骤:
-
准备数据:
- 静态热力图需要有一定的数据支撑,通常是一组数值数据,这些数据可以代表某种指标的大小、分布或变化情况。可以使用 Excel、CSV 文件或其他数据格式来存储这些数据。
-
选择合适的工具:
- 制作静态热力图的常用工具包括 Python 的 Matplotlib 库、R 语言中的 ggplot2 等。Matplotlib 是一个功能强大的 Python 数据可视化库,提供了丰富的绘图功能,包括绘制热力图。
-
处理数据:
- 在使用工具之前,需要对数据进行处理,确保数据格式正确、完整。数据处理包括数据清洗、筛选、排序等操作,以确保最终的热力图能够清晰展示数据趋势。
-
绘制热力图:
- 使用选定的工具,按照数据的分布和需求,绘制热力图。在 Matplotlib 中,可以使用
imshow函数来绘制热力图,通过调整参数如颜色映射、图例等,使热力图更加直观和美观。
- 使用选定的工具,按照数据的分布和需求,绘制热力图。在 Matplotlib 中,可以使用
-
设计样式和颜色:
- 静态热力图的设计样式和颜色搭配也很关键。可以根据数据的性质选择合适的颜色映射,例如使用渐变色来表示数据大小,同时可调整图表的背景色、标签字体等,以增强信息传达效果。
-
添加标签和注释(可选):
- 如果需要突出某些数据点或区域,可以添加标签或注释,以便观众更好地理解图表。这可以通过工具提供的文本注释功能实现,或者在图表上手动添加标签。
-
导出图片:
- 完成热力图的设计后,可以将其导出为图片格式(如 PNG、JPG 等),以便在报告、演示文稿或网站上使用。导出图片时可以调整分辨率和尺寸,确保图像质量。
通过以上步骤,您可以制作出具有视觉吸引力和信息表达力的静态热力图,帮助观众更直观地理解数据分布和趋势。
1年前 -
-
制作静态热力图标图片需要使用数据可视化工具或者编程语言来实现。下面我将介绍两种常见的制作方法:使用数据可视化工具和使用编程语言(如Python)制作静态热力图标图片。
使用数据可视化工具进行制作
-
选择适合的工具: 可以使用诸如Tableau、Microsoft Power BI、Google Data Studio等数据可视化工具。
-
导入数据: 将需要制作热力图标的数据导入到所选工具中。
-
选择热力图标类型: 在数据可视化工具中,选择热力图标类型,并设置X轴、Y轴以及颜色编码字段。
-
调整颜色和范围: 根据数据的分布情况和需求,调整颜色梯度、数值范围等参数。
-
添加标签和注释: 可以添加标签、注释或者其他附加信息,使热力图标更易读和易懂。
-
导出图片: 在数据可视化工具中,将制作好的热力图标导出为图片格式,如PNG、JPG等。
使用编程语言进行制作(以Python为例)
-
导入所需库: 使用Python,首先导入Matplotlib库中的pyplot模块。
-
准备数据: 准备需要制作热力图标的数据,通常是二维数组或者DataFrame。
-
绘制热力图标: 使用Matplotlib中的imshow函数来绘制热力图标,可以设置颜色映射、标签等参数。
-
添加标签和注释: 可以使用Matplotlib中的annotate函数添加标签和注释。
-
调整样式: 可以根据需要调整图表的样式、颜色梯度等参数。
-
保存图片: 最后使用Matplotlib中的savefig函数保存生成的热力图标图片。
通过以上两种方法,你可以根据自己的需求和熟练程度选择适合自己的制作方式,制作出美观、易读的静态热力图标图片。希望这些方法对你有所帮助!
1年前 -
-
制作静态热力图标图片是一种用于展示数据分布密集程度的可视化方法。通常情况下,静态热力图标图片用不同颜色的热力图层叠显示在地图或图片上,展示不同区域的数据密集程度,呈现出明显的色彩变化。接下来,我将为你详细讲解如何制作静态热力图标图片。
1. 数据准备
首先,你需要准备好要展示的数据,确保数据格式清晰、完整。热力图的数据通常是经纬度坐标和相应的权重值,可以代表该位置的数据密集程度。可以使用Excel或其他数据处理软件整理数据,确保数据格式的准确性和完整性。
2. 选择合适的工具
制作静态热力图标图片需要使用专业的数据可视化工具,常用的工具包括:
- QGIS:是一个专业的开源地理信息系统软件,提供了丰富的数据处理、编辑、展示功能,适合制作热力图标图片。
- ArcGIS:是一款领先的商业地理信息系统软件,功能强大,适合处理地理空间数据和制作各种地图。
- Google Maps API:提供了丰富的地图定制功能,可以通过API接口制作热力图标图片。
3. 导入数据
使用选定的工具,导入准备好的数据文件,确保数据能够正确显示在地图或图片上。对数据进行必要的处理,比如坐标转换、数据清洗等。
4. 制作热力图
QGIS制作热力图的步骤如下:
- 在图层管理器中右键单击数据图层,选择“属性”。
- 进入“属性”窗口,在“样式”选项卡中选择“热力图”。
- 在“热力图”设置中,选择合适的渲染半径、半径单位和颜色渐变,调整透明度等参数。
- 点击“应用”并预览效果,优化调整图层显示效果。
- 完成后,导出地图为静态图片格式。
ArcGIS制作热力图的步骤如下:
- 在ArcMap中打开数据文件,选择“插入”-“新增数据框”以及需要显示热力图的数据。
- 进入“图层属性”窗口,选择“渐变符号”或“唯一值渲染”。
- 调整渲染参数,如色带、透明度等,预览效果。
- 可以通过“输出”-“制图”导出地图为静态图片格式。
Google Maps API制作热力图的步骤如下:
- 使用Google提供的API接口加载地图,并将数据点按照经纬度添加到地图中。
- 设置热力图的属性,如权重值、颜色渐变等。
- 使用API中提供的方法制作热力图标图片,可以使用Canvas绘制热力图,最后导出为静态图片。
5. 导出和分享
制作完成后,导出生成的热力图标图片,可以选择常见的图片格式如PNG、JPG等。分享热力图标图片到需要展示的平台,如报告、网站等。
通过以上步骤,你可以制作出漂亮、直观的静态热力图标图片,展示数据的空间分布情况。希望这些信息能帮助你顺利完成制作工作!
1年前